The Lunch Sides at Aunt Di’s Cafe stand out with the Loaded Potatoes—a decadent treat piled high with gooey nacho cheese and crispy bacon pieces, priced reasonably at $11.25. It’s a warm, indulgent side that elevates any meal. For lighter options, their Fruit Cup and Side Salad, each $2.50, provide fresh, healthy contrasts. The Wedges, available as either regular or sweet potato, showcase a perfect balance of crispy exterior and tender inside, suitable for those craving a classic comfort snack. Their soups — wedding, cheddar broccoli, and pasta fagioli — offer a rich, homemade quality that feels like a warm embrace during any season, with a moderate price point of $6.00.
Family-friendly, Aunt Di’s Cafe thoughtfully includes a Kids’ Menu that feels both fun and filling. The Junior Burger comes with toppings, chips, and a drink for just $5.50, making it a solid choice for young diners. Pancake options—Chocolate Chip Pancakes (two pancakes with syrup) and Mickey Mouse Pancakes (one pancake with syrup)—are whimsically designed to delight children, priced at $5.00 and $4.00 respectively. The Hot Dog, paired with chips and a drink, offers another simple, kid-approved meal at $5.00.
Beverage options here are straightforward and classic. The Ice Tea at just $1.00 and Coffee at $1.75 complement the breakfast and lunch dishes with familiarity and ease. Tea and Orange Drink extend the variety modestly, while Water and canned soft drinks cover the essentials without fuss.
